Skyward Specialty Appoints Patricia Ryan as New General Counsel

Skyward Specialty's New Chapter with Patricia Ryan
Skyward Specialty Insurance Group, Inc.™ (NASDAQ: SKWD) has taken a significant step forward by appointing Patricia Ryan as its new General Counsel. This strategic move comes in light of the upcoming retirement of Leslie Shaunty, who has devoted nearly 12 years to the company. As the new General Counsel effective April 1, Patricia Ryan is poised to bring invaluable expertise and fresh perspectives to the company.
Patricia Ryan's Rich Background
With over 20 years of experience in the insurance industry, Ryan has cultivated a well-rounded legal career that includes serving as Chief Legal Officer and General Counsel for various prominent organizations. Her extensive background encompasses critical areas, including compliance, regulatory matters, corporate governance, and enterprise risk management. Prior to her significant tenure in the insurance field, Ryan practiced law in private settings, equipping her with a multifaceted understanding of legal issues.

Transitioning Leadership
Leslie Shaunty has played a pivotal role in shaping Skyward Specialty's legal and compliance frameworks, contributing to the successful IPO and subsequent offerings over the years. Robinson acknowledged Shaunty's unwavering commitment: "Her expertise and drive were central to our achievements as a public company. We extend our heartfelt thanks to Leslie for her lasting impact and wish her the very best in her retirement."
Skyward Specialty: Driving Innovation in Insurance
Skyward Specialty continues to emerge as a robust player in the specialty property and casualty insurance market. The company offers a range of flexible and innovative insurance solutions through its eight underwriting divisions, including Accident & Health, Captives, Global Property & Agriculture, and more. Each division is tailored to meet the diverse needs of customers across various sectors.
